Baron De Ley (2009)

Baron De Ley Finca Monasterio (Rioja

Tempranillo-Cabernet Sauvignon · Rioja, Spain

From public reviewers

2reviews
88median pts
$55median price
Roasted, toasty aromas are the greeting on this Tempranillo-based blend (20% Cabernet). It's a fresh yet oaky type of Rioja, with resiny creaminess cut by lively acidity. Flavors of vanilla, plum, raspberry and tobacco are traditional, while the finish is mild, crisp and snappy.
